HTML5 palette
Picture boxes, text boxes, anchored boxes, and no-content boxes support different
kinds of interactivity. Options that are not available for the selected item are disabled.
At the bottom of the palette, there is a list of all of the interactive objects in the active
layout, including each enrichment type, object's name, and page number. You can
navigate to any object listed here by double-clicking it.
Once you apply interactivity to a box, the application adds an icon to the box to show
what kind of interactivity it has. To view these icons, make sure View > Visual
Indicators is checked. The icons are as follows:
